1. A method for measuring and adjusting pressure of one or more tires intended to provide the tire with an appropriate pressure when the tire is under conditions of temperature and pressure unequal to nominal values of temperature and pressure which correspond to a temperature defined as ambient temperature, and a pressure defined as the appropriate pressure for the tire at ambient temperature while the tire is at rest, the method comprising the following steps:

  • measuring the pressure inside the tire;

    measuring the temperature inside the tire;

    calculating a pressure value equivalent to the nominal pressure as a function of said measured temperature value, said calculated equivalent pressure being an appropriate pressure for use in the tire at the measured temperature conditions;

    displaying the measured temperature and pressure values, as well as the value of the pressure calculated as equivalent to the nominal as a function of said measured value of temperature;

    introducing said calculated equivalent pressure value into an air supplying machine; and

    supplying said calculated equivalent pressure into the tire.
